当前位置:首页 / EXCEL

Excel如何减小内存占用?如何优化处理大数据?

作者:佚名|分类:EXCEL|浏览:99|发布时间:2025-03-17 15:03:40

Excel如何减小内存占用?如何优化处理大数据?

在当今数据驱动的世界中,Excel作为最常用的数据处理工具之一,经常面临处理大量数据时的内存占用问题。以下是一些有效的方法来减小Excel的内存占用,并优化处理大数据的能力。

一、减小Excel内存占用的方法

1. 关闭自动计算

Excel的自动计算功能在后台不断更新公式,这会占用大量内存。可以通过以下步骤关闭自动计算:

点击“文件”菜单,选择“选项”。

在“计算”选项卡中,将“自动计算”设置为“关闭”。

2. 减少工作表中的数据

删除不必要的列和行:只保留你需要的数据。

使用数据透视表:将大量数据汇总到透视表中,可以大大减少工作表中的数据量。

3. 优化数据类型

避免使用文本格式存储数字:将文本格式的数字转换为数字类型可以减少内存占用。

使用数据验证:通过数据验证来限制输入的数据类型和范围。

4. 使用分页符

分页符可以帮助你将数据分散到多个工作表中,从而减少单个工作表的内存占用。

5. 清除缓存

定期清除Excel的缓存可以释放内存。可以通过以下步骤清除缓存:

点击“文件”菜单,选择“选项”。

在“高级”选项卡中,找到“编辑”部分,点击“清除缓存”。

二、优化处理大数据的方法

1. 使用Excel的数据透视表

数据透视表是一种强大的工具,可以快速分析大量数据,并且不会占用太多内存。

2. 使用Power Query

Power Query是Excel的一个内置功能,可以帮助你清洗、转换和合并数据,从而优化数据处理。

3. 使用Excel的“获取外部数据”

通过“获取外部数据”功能,可以直接从数据库、网页或其他Excel文件中导入数据,而不需要手动输入。

4. 使用宏和VBA

对于复杂的计算和数据处理任务,可以使用宏和VBA脚本来自动化操作,提高效率。

5. 使用Excel的“分析工具库”

分析工具库提供了一系列用于统计分析的函数和工具,可以帮助你更有效地处理大数据。

三、总结

通过上述方法,你可以有效地减小Excel的内存占用,并优化处理大数据的能力。以下是一些常见问题的解答。

相关问答

1. 如何在不关闭Excel的情况下减小内存占用?

回答:可以通过调整Excel的设置来减少内存占用,例如关闭自动计算、减少工作表中的数据、优化数据类型等。

2. 数据透视表如何帮助处理大数据?

回答:数据透视表可以快速汇总大量数据,减少工作表中的数据量,从而降低内存占用。

3. Power Query与Excel的数据导入有何区别?

回答:Power Query提供了更强大的数据清洗和转换功能,而Excel的数据导入功能则更简单,主要用于直接导入数据。

4. 如何使用VBA来处理大数据?

回答:可以通过编写VBA脚本来自动化数据处理任务,例如数据清洗、转换和合并等。

通过以上方法,你可以更好地利用Excel处理大数据,提高工作效率。记住,合理使用Excel的功能和工具是关键。